BLUE MOUNTAIN ENERGY, INC. <br />Permit No. 89RB317F <br />Final Approval <br />Page 3 <br />PARTICULATE EMISSIONS CONTROL PLAN FOR MINING ACTIVITIES <br />THE FOLLOWING PARTICULATE EMISSIONS CONTROL MEASURES SHALL BE USED FOR COMPLIANCE <br />PURPOSES ON THE ACTIVITIES COVERED BY THIS PERMIT, AS REQUIRED BY THE AIR QUALITY <br />CONTROL COMMISSION REGULATION N0.1, Section III.D.t.b. THIS SOURCE IS SUBJECT TO THE <br />FOLLOWING EMISSION GUIDELINES: <br />a. Mining Activities -Visible emissions not to exceed 20%, no off-property transport of visible <br />emissions. <br />Control Measures <br />1. Fugitive emissions from top soil removal & stockpiling shall be controlled by water spray to <br />maintain a surface moisture content of 3% or greater, and shall be revegetated within 6 months. <br />2. Fugitive emissions from overburden removal & stockpiling shall be controlled by water spray to <br />maintain a surface moisture content of 3% or greater, and shall be revegetated within 6 months. <br />3. Fugitive emissions from excavation, loading & stockpiling coal refuse shall be controlled by water <br />• spray to maintain a surface moisture content of 4% or greater, and the pile shall be compacted and <br />revegetated within one year. <br />4. Surfaces left undisturbed (maximum of 33.64 acres) for 6 months or more shall be revegetated <br />and/or watered regularly to maintain surface moisture content of 3°k or greater. <br />• <br />1 0 31001 4/007 <br />
